Cultural Tourism

Cultural tourism (also culture tourism) is the subset of tourism concerned with a country or region's culture, especially its arts. Cultural tourism includes tourism in urban areas, particularly historic or large cities and their cultural facilities such as museums and theatres. It can also, less often, include tourism to rural areas; for outdoor festivals, the houses of famous writers & artists, sculpture parks, and landscapes made famous in literature. It is generally agreed that cultural tourists spend substantially more than standard tourists do. See also: heritage tourism.
